IT is strange to see a writer on philosophy like Mr. S. H. Hodgson, as well as physicists so exceptionally able as Prof. Clifford, and now Prof. Clerk Maxwell, falling into the same errors of observation as more ordinary mortals. Neither the authors of the ``Unseen Universe'', nor any of the members of the Paradoxical Society, have, so far as I am aware, expressed the notion that the invisible order of things which continuity requires a; antecedent to the visible order, is in any sense material. They only assume that it must be conditioned. Indeed, the authors of the ``Unseen Universe'' have expressed this conviction in the preface to the second edition of their work, in italics, and in language that is not only exceedingly clear, but also extremely strong.
